That is actually some sort of Monument at the Chalmette Battlefield where th e Battle of New Orleans took place. the whole field where each side stood it's ground is marked off. There is a trail around it all with stations displaying how we won the field. On the other side of the field is a national Cemetery where all the old soldiers were buried. many unmarked graves.
